
Cozy Shepherd's Pie Soup is like your favorite comforting casserole but in a bowl ready to warm you up any night of the week. I love how this soup captures those classic flavors and heartiness without needing to fuss over mashed potatoes or oven time. It is a one-pot wonder you will crave all fall and winter.
I started making this when my oldest went through a shepherds pie obsession and now my house always smells like this when the weather turns chilly. It is a serious family favorite that never stays in the fridge long.
Ingredients
- Olive oil: gives richness and helps build flavor when sauteing
- Small onion: forms the aromatic base and adds sweetness choose firm onions with shiny skins
- Garlic: boosts the comforting aroma always go for fresh, plump cloves
- Lean ground beef: gives the soup body and classic taste use grass fed for extra flavor if you can
- Salt: for seasoning divide so the flavors build in layers
- All purpose flour: thickens the soup and makes it extra hearty sift it in to avoid clumps
- Cold water: forms the broth and helps the flour dissolve smoothly use filtered water if possible
- Carrots: bring sweetness and color pick ones that are firm and bright orange
- Baking potatoes: make the soup filling and creamy cut them small for faster cooking
- Corn kernels: add a pop of sweetness try to use sweet corn for the best results
- Green peas: provide color and a soft texture frozen peas taste just as good as fresh
Step by Step Instructions
- Prepare the Vegetables:
- Heat olive oil in a Dutch oven or large pot over medium heat Add the diced onion and chopped carrots Cook for about three minutes until softened Then add garlic and cook for one more minute until fragrant
- Brown the Beef:
- Add lean ground beef and half the salt Stir and break up the meat with a spoon Cook until beef is browned and cooked through about five to six minutes Sprinkle flour over the mixture and stir until evenly coated
- Make the Broth:
- Gradually drizzle in a quarter cup of cold water at a time Stir well after each addition until you have stirred in one cup of water This helps avoid lumps Add the rest of the water then the cubed potatoes and the remaining salt Stir well and partially cover the pot
- Simmer the Soup:
- Bring to a boil over high heat then reduce to a simmer Cook partially covered seven to eight minutes until potatoes are fork tender For extra texture gently mash some potatoes with a masher in the pot
- Finish and Serve:
- Stir in the corn and peas Cook another two to three minutes until heated through Taste and season with more salt or black pepper if you like Serve hot for maximum comfort

Tiny cubes of potato are my secret They cook quickly and make every spoonful extra creamy and satisfying My little one always tries to fish out as many peas as possible from their bowl It has turned into a family challenge to see who finds the most peas
Storage Tips
Let the soup cool before storing Transfer to airtight containers and keep in the fridge for up to four days For longer storage freeze in single portions and thaw overnight in the fridge The soup may thicken after cooling so add a splash of water or broth when reheating
Ingredient Substitutions
You can swap ground turkey or chicken for the beef Just add more seasoning for flavor Vegan grounds work well too try to add a dash of soy sauce for extra savoriness Sweet potatoes make a tasty substitute for regular potatoes if you want added color and nutrition
Serving Suggestions
Serve the soup with a crusty piece of bread or a fresh green salad For an extra comforting touch sprinkle grated cheddar over each bowl and let it melt You can also stir in a spoonful of sour cream just before serving

Cultural Historical Context
Shepherds pie is a traditional dish from the United Kingdom usually made with ground lamb or beef and topped with mashed potatoes Turning it into a soup is an American twist that lets you enjoy all the elements in a fuss free format My family loves this shortcut version because it delivers nostalgia and ease all in one
Recipe FAQs
- → What type of potatoes work best for this soup?
Baking potatoes hold their shape while still breaking down enough for mashing, which creates a creamy, rustic broth. Yukon Golds are also a good substitute if desired.
- → Can I use ground turkey instead of beef?
Yes, ground turkey can be used for a lighter flavor profile while retaining a hearty texture. Adjust seasoning to your preference.
- → How should I serve this dish?
Ladle into warm bowls and serve with crusty bread. A sprinkle of fresh herbs like parsley adds extra color and flavor.
- → Can leftovers be stored and reheated?
Absolutely! Store cooled soup in an airtight container in the refrigerator for up to three days. Reheat gently on the stove, adding a splash of water if needed to loosen the broth.
- → What vegetables can be added or substituted?
This dish is flexible—try adding diced parsnips, celery, or using frozen mixed vegetables. Adjust cooking times depending on additions.